Small bowel resection is a surgical procedure aimed at removing a diseased portion of the small intestine, typically due to conditions such as Crohn's disease, cancer, intestinal obstruction, or traumatic injury. The small intestine, comprised of the duodenum, jejunum, and ileum, plays a crucial role in digestion and nutrient absorption. During this procedure, a surgeon makes an incision in the abdomen to access the small intestine, identifying the affected segment that needs removal. Once the diseased portion is located, the surgeon carefully disconnects it from the surrounding tissues and blood vessels. There are different techniques for resection, including an open approach, which involves a larger incision, and minimally invasive techniques, such as laparoscopic surgery, which utilizes smaller incisions and specialized instruments. The type of surgery chosen depends on the specific condition being treated, the patient's overall health, and the surgeon's expertise. After the removal of the affected section, the healthy ends of the intestine are then reconnected in a process called anastomosis. This reconnection allows for a continuous passage of food through the digestive tract. In some cases, if a significant portion of the intestine is removed, the surgeon may create an ostomy, an opening that allows waste to exit the body into a bag outside of the body while the remaining intestine recovers. Recovery from small bowel resection varies among patients, depending on factors such as the extent of the surgery, the underlying reason for the resection, and individual health conditions. Generally, patients are monitored in the hospital for a few days following surgery to ensure that they are eating and drinking adequately, that bowel function returns, and to watch for any signs of complications such as infections, bleeding, or leaks at the anastomosis site. Post-operative care is crucial and may include dietary adjustments, medication to manage pain or prevent infection, and follow-up appointments to monitor recovery. Patients are typically advised to gradually reintroduce foods to their diet, starting with liquids and progressing to solid foods as tolerated. Long-term outcomes from small bowel resection can vary; while many patients experience significant improvement in their symptoms and quality of life, some may face issues such as short bowel syndrome, where the remaining intestine is insufficient for proper digestion and absorption. Nutrition plays a vital role in the recovery process, and patients may need consultation with a dietitian to optimize their diet post-surgery. Overall, small bowel resection is considered a relatively safe and effective procedure that can significantly alleviate symptoms related to small intestinal diseases and improve the patient's overall well-being. It is essential for patients to engage in open communication with their healthcare team to understand the risks, benefits, and long-term implications of the procedure as they navigate their recovery journey.
